I used Garamond 11pt for my paperback:

http://www.lulu.com/spotlight/books_by_paul_robinson

If you're publishing in eBook format it doesn't really matter (provided that your text looks correct relative to any pictures/diagrams) as users will view it on so many different devices that it will get zoomed in/out as required.

The best advice I can offer is to use text 'styles' consistently throughout your manuscript while writing; it is painful to have to format the entire book afterwards. Also, resist the temptation to insert blank lines with the 'enter' key and use 'heading' styles for titles etc. Also, also (!), once you think you have it right, order a single copy to check - I discovered that my page numbers were incorrectly positioned due to incorrect formatting. Once you're happy with everything you can 'release' your masterpiece to the world at large. Consider this if relevant: http://www.bl.uk/aboutus/legaldeposit/

The advantage that Lulu offers is ease of distribution in various formats - you can publish in 'proper' book format and various eBook formats easily and get your work into various distribution channels eg. Amazon, iBookstore, Barnes & Noble etc. Their forums are also very helpful for new authors.
